          This Report is recognized worldwide as an authoritative source of information and analysis on Foreign Direct Investment (FDI). This year's Report looks in detail at the forces behind the continued decline in FDI globally. It evaluates how the various regions and countries fared and forecasts the chances for recovery and growth at the global and regional levels. The Report also assesses the interaction between national and international FDI policies and examines implications they have on development. It concludes by highlighting the key issues, from the perspective of development, that must be considered in investment agreements.

          The Peninsula Campaign (Spring 1862) ended with Union Gen. George McClellan's failure to capture Richmond, due largely to his overcautiousness as well as the bold and often costly attacks from Confederate Gen. Robert E. Lee's army which eventually took the fight out of McCellan's army. Or, at least out of McCellan himself! The campaign made the North realize that a swift end to the war was impossible, and Lee's military brilliance was emerging as well. Although the bloody battles of the Peninsula Campaign were very costly to both sides, McClellan's advance was brought to a halt and Richmond was saved. This outstanding book is yet another great "eyewitness history" from Richard Wheeler, who carefully weaved together scores of Union and Confederate accounts of the campaign to tell the full story. There are dozens of sketches and drawings from the period, as well as many period maps, although the maps aren't very good. To understand this important campaign from the soldiers' perspective, this is THE book to read. I'd look elsewhere for adequate maps of the campaign, though. Overall, highly recommended for Civil War buffs.

                  SWORD OVER RICHMOND, told largely in the words of participants and observers, recounts General George McClellan's attempt to outflank the Confederate forces early in the Civil War. He proposed to ferry his army down the Potomac and Chesapeake, then march up the Virginia peninsula and attack Richmond, the Confederate capital, from the east.

                  Short, dapper and full of confidence, McClellan's appointment as commander of the Army of the Potomac came in the aftermath of the disastrous Union defeat at Bull Run. McClellan looked like another Napoleon and thought he was, but underneath he was overcautious, a fatal flaw in a war leader.

                  In the end his campaign was a failure. It dashed all hope for a quick end to the conflict, and finally convinced Lincoln to issue the Emancipation Proclamation.

                            This landmark study of the material well-being of older people in nine OECD countries—Canada, Finland, Germany, Italy, Japan, the Netherlands, Sweden, the United Kingdom, and the United States—uses a wealth of new data to shed light on the challenges facing policy-makers as they anticipate the coming retirement of the baby-boom generation. The findings are often surprising. In all the countries surveyed, policies have been fundamentally successful, with older people at all income levels tending to maintain or even increase their material standards of living once they stop working. This happens despite large differences in approaches to public policy, including the size of public pensions. The systems that provide resources to older people are considerably more complex than is usually taken into account in policy-making, and the effects of policy, while large, are less direct than often thought. Ageing and Income examines the many diverse ways in which the nine countries are tackling this challenge and the lessons that have been learned from their experiences.

                            In Dakota Boy, a skilled writer gives a thoughtful, entertaining account of his childhood in North DakotaÂ's Red River Valley in the 1940Â's and early Â'50Â's, depicting the haphazard, often comical, hit-and-miss process by which the child and adolescent tries to build an identity. Along the way, he traces the gradual expansion of social consciousness, explores his puzzling, unsatisfying relationship with his distant, taciturn father, and shows the indelible, inescapable influence of the Northern Plains environment: the severe climate, the table flat fields of potatoes and wheat under an intimidating expanse of sky, and the mid century strictures of Scandinavian-Lutheran conservatism.

                            In the end, he says, “I realized that trying to shake my past was futile, that like it or not IÂ'd just have to go through life with a certain amount of North Dakota on my shoes.”

                                    The "bottom line" for the World Bank is its development effectiveness. The independent Operations Evaluation Department (OED) tracks the Bank's development performance, analyzing the effectiveness of Bank projects, programs, and processes; draws lessons of operational experience; and provides advice to the World Bank Board based on evaluations at the project, country, sector, and thematic levels.

                                    This year's Review assesses how the World Bank's country, sector, and global programs are helping clients work toward the Millennium Development Goals and related targets. It finds that while continuity is called for in some areas of the Bank's work, there is need for far greater emphasis in others, and perhaps even changes and innovations in yet other Bank practices and priorities.

                                    Download Description

                                    This is the sixth Annual Review of Development Effectiveness (ARDE), covering the year 2002, whose findings indicate that the Bank ' s country, sector, and global programs are consistent with the Millennium Development Goals (MDG) themes, increasingly focused on poverty reduction. The review assesses, and evaluates the outcomes of its development assistance, indicating that at the project level, outcomes continue to improve, with seventy seven percent satisfactory ratings in FY01 (exceeding for a second year the Strategic Compact target of seventy five percent); over two thirds of projects were rated as likely, or highly likely to be sustained; and, one half rated as having substantial, or higher institutional development impacts. Sector strategies show increasing attention to poverty linkages, although findings suggest intensified efforts in the identification of relevant development outcomes, and corresponding intermediate indicators, as well as strengthening capacities, and incentives to monitor, and evaluate development outcomes. The Bank must move from recognizing the multi-sectoral determinants of development outcomes, to developing and implementing cross-sectoral strategies. Above all, the Bank needs to fully assess the implications at the corporate, country, sector, and global levels of the MDGs, and address these implications in its use of lending, and administrative resources.

                                    His father, Abe, was a superb salesman who parlayed personal charm and client loyalty into success despite a series of debilitating ailments. His mother, Stella, was a painter who numbered among her friends Jackson Pollock and Louise Nevelson; she despised the affluent lifestyle her husband cultivated and viewed his taking a job with her father's lighting-fixture company as a betrayal. Before and after their divorce, writes Fred Waitzkin, "Mother and Dad warred within me." His unsparing memoir depicts a larger war within the family waged by grandparents, aunts and uncles, and his own brother, who fled from their parents' troubles into a bohemian, self-destructive life. Young Fred embraced orthodox Judaism and "cultivated [his] conventional side" to emulate Abe, yet he also dreamed of being a writer. Through it all, fishing--beloved by Abe, despised by Stella--remained his escape and his comfort. Waitzkin, who proved with Searching for Bobby Fischer that he could use the particulars of an avocation to illuminate the emotional needs it assuaged, does the same here with wonderfully evocative details about fishing. A closing scene chronicling a 1998 hunt for tuna with his wife and two children tentatively suggests that this generation of Waitzkins has found some measure of the happiness that eluded Abe and Stella. --Wendy Smith

                                    Young Fred Waitzkin is a Jewish boy stretched between the divergent values of parents who cannot tolerate one another. Fred's father, Abe, is a brilliantly talented salesman whose relentless will drives him to succeed-he literally brightens American cities with fluorescent lighting fixtures. Abe marries Stella, an abstract artist and daughter of a wealthy industrialist with whom Abe forges an alliance. When his parents' marriage disintegrates, Fred retreats into fishing, learning the trade from the master captains of Bimini. In scenes ranging from Long Island synagogues to evenings with famous painters to the boats of drug smugglers and the once marlin-rich waters of the Gulf Stream, Fred sinks boats and battles thousand-pounders believing that fishing is the only hope. Woven through this compelling narrative are moving insights about childhood, families, and a love of the sea.
